It depends a lot on how often and how you drive the car. Starting the car will require driving 20 minutes to re-charge the battery. If you do a lot of short trips, it's easy to drain the battery.

FWIW, I found the Ctek chargers to be great if you have a healthy battery, but not strong enough to bring back a flat battery. I switched to this charger http://www.saveabattery.com/. It's a great charger/maintainer and works much better than the Ctek.
